Abstract

We showed that imaging performance of microsphere-assisted microscopy technique is influenced by the index of the background medium surrounding the microspheres. Our results provide further evidence for the connection between focusing and imaging properties of the microspheres and establish a robust platform for design optimization of microsphere-embedded devices for super-resolution microscopy.
